Introducing Skilljar and The Brainier LMS

Skilljar, The Brainier LMS, Lessonly, Litmos, etc., belong to a category of solutions that help Learning Management System. Different products excel in different areas, so the best platform for your business will depend on your specific needs and requirements.

Skilljar covers Training & Onboarding, Engagement Management, Customer Feedback Management with Promotions, Lifetime Value Management, etc.

The Brainier LMS focuses on Training & Onboarding, Engagement Management, Content Management, Courses & Assessment, etc.
